Died, at the home of her daughter, Mrs. Sinnette Richardson, on Wednesday morning, Oct. 13, 1897, of dropsy, Mrs. Phoebe Florville Coleman, widow of William Florville, aged 76 years. The deceased was colored and was well known in this city. She was born in Kentucky and has been a resident of this state for the past sixty years. Her husband was a well known barber. She leaves to mourn her loss two children, Mrs. Richardson and William S. Florville; one sister, Mrs. Sophia Huggins, four grandchildren, seventeen great grandchildren and three great, great grandchildren. Interment in Oak Ridge cemetery.
